A Complete Look at the Itinerary and Experience

Starting at Buckingham Palace and the Changing of the Guard

The tour kicks off with a classic London experience — a photo stop at Buckingham Palace. Depending on the day, you’ll get to see the Changing of the Guard, a spectacle that draws crowds but is often well worth the early wake-up. The guide can advise on the best viewing spots and share behind-the-scenes details about this centuries-old ceremony.

Exploring Westminster and Parliament

From there, you’ll move through Westminster, passing Westminster Abbey, the Houses of Parliament, and Big Ben. The guide’s commentary here makes this part special, giving context about the political and royal significance of these buildings. We loved the way guides can heighten the experience with little stories or facts not found in guidebooks.

Iconic Sights Along the Thames

Next, the boat-shaped London Eye appears as a modern contrast to historic landmarks. While this isn’t a ride included in the tour, the guide often points out the best spots for photos. A walk through Trafalgar Square and St James’s Park adds a touch of greenery and city bustle, a welcome break from the car.

Tower of London and Tower Bridge

The heart of London’s history, the Tower of London, offers a chance to snap photos of its imposing walls and learn about its role as a royal fortress and treasury. Our review mentions that while entry tickets aren’t included, the external views alone make this worth the stop. The nearby Tower Bridge provides a stunning backdrop for sightseeing shots, especially in good weather.

Exploring West London

After crossing the river, the drive continues through Kensington, where stops at Kensington Gardens, the Diana Princess of Wales statue, and Kensington Palace give a regal touch. Walking around the gardens, you’ll appreciate the lush scenery and elegant architecture.

Notting Hill and the Market

A highlight for many is the stop at Notting Hill, particularly near Portobello Market. The vibrant streets, colorful houses, and lively market atmosphere make for a fun exploration — whether you want to browse antiques or just soak up the vibe with your guide pointing out hidden gems.

What’s Included and What’s Not?

The tour includes all the key sights, photo stops, a knowledgeable guide, and comfort amenities. However, entry fees to attractions are not included, so if you wish to go inside sites like the Tower of London, you’ll need to purchase tickets separately. Also, lunch is not included, but the guide can suggest nearby options or help you plan a quick stop during the day.
